0

I am using WordPress with Neve theme, for my site, Favicon is working on posts/pages, but Favicons aren't visible for JPG/PNG/Videos.

If I use the Theme Customizer and select the Favicon PNG image, it shows on all posts and images etc.

But I want to have different Favicon Images on different URLs.

I saw that Theme was adding the below code on my site in Head.

<link rel="apple-touch-icon" sizes="72x72" href="https://milyin.com/wp-content/uploads/Icons/Icon72x72.png">
<link rel="icon" type="image/png" sizes="32x32" href="https://milyin.com/wp-content/uploads/Icons/Icon32x32.png">
<link rel="icon" type="image/png" sizes="16x16" href="https://milyin.com/wp-content/uploads/Icons/Icon16x16.png">

this code was inserted wp_head to make it work.

It works perfectly on my posts and pages. For example the post How Does Elon Musk Manage all his Companies Effectively? the favicon is visible perfectly.

But if I Image from the save post The Image shows favicon as WordPress logo instead of my site logo.

How to make it WordPress logo programatically.

1 Answer 1

1

When opening media files only the file is loaded and not the html head of your file.

You can add a 'favicon.ico' file ('.png' may also work – not sure) to your root directory ('public_html/', 'www/' 'domain.com/' depending on server setup) and it should load even for media files as browsers are automaticly looking for an icon there.

3
  • Well, I know that html head is empty for Media files.... However how am I supposed to add the ion... What should be the name of file and where to place it? Commented Sep 6, 2021 at 3:09
  • 1
    The name should be 'favicon' and it should be in the 'root directory'. You can add it using ftp... Commented Sep 6, 2021 at 9:16
  • Confirmed that you'll need to upload "favicon.ico" to the web root, and that worked for me
    – Hector
    Commented Oct 12, 2023 at 22:07

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.